2nd Annual Young Decision Makers Conference

category dublin | gender and sexuality | event notice author Tuesday July 01, 2008 11:52author by Rebecca Hurst - Irish Family Planning Association Report this post to the editors


The Irish Family Planning Association (IFPA) is holding the second annual ‘Young Decision Makers Conference’ in Dublin on the 4th July in Croke Park, for 100 people and would like to invite you, or any young people you know who might be interested, to take part.

The conference is also open to youth workers or people with a special interest in SRHR/sexual health issues or the needs of young people.

The day will involve interactive workshops and talks on sexual and reproductive health and rights. It will look at both the national situation here in Ireland, specifically at access to services, and at the international situation with an international speaker.
The conference will also look at the use of the media in this field, and there will be interactive sessions so participants can learn how to use the tools that are so readily at their disposal to bring about change, and truly become young decision makers!
